On a real subject, does anyone have a cursor screw for an Aristo 0970? I
recently bought one
that has one screw missing. John Mosand was kind enough to send one, however it
appears
Aristo made two length screws for this cursor. Now isn't that s surprise :)
Anyway, the one I
am looking for is the shorter version, only about 3 mm long.
